How Scripture is sourced
Scripture on our public pages is the King James Version (public domain), always cited with its reference. Inside the app the default is the New International Version. We never mix translations silently, and we identify the translation on every quotation.
Our theological approach
We write from mere Christianity: Scripture-first, warm, and non-denominational. Where Christian traditions genuinely differ, we aim to describe the difference rather than flatten it, and we distinguish the plain text of Scripture from interpretation.
How we use AI
Some content and translations are AI-assisted, then held to a human, Scripture-grounded standard before publishing. Our companion, Simon, is clearly labeled AI, can be wrong, is not clergy or a counselor, and speaks with no divine authority. Test everything against Scripture. Accuracy & corrections
We ground claims in Scripture and cite our sources. If something here is wrong, tell us at hello@living-bread.org and we will correct it. Substantive corrections are dated; we do not manipulate timestamps to fake freshness.
Community contributions
Prayers and testimonies shared by the community are moderated and only ever made public with the author’s explicit consent. Private prayers and messages are never published.
